5. Setlist Composition

Setlist composition, in the context of a hypothetical Maggie Rogers performance at Walmart AMP, is a critical element influencing audience satisfaction and the overall success of the concert. The selection and arrangement of songs significantly impacts the energy, pacing, and memorability of the event.

  • Balancing Familiar Hits with Newer Material

    A successful setlist strategically blends well-known and commercially successful songs with newer, potentially less familiar material. This approach caters to long-time fans while simultaneously introducing the audience to more recent artistic endeavors. Too much emphasis on new material risks alienating a portion of the audience, while solely relying on older hits can stagnate the concert experience. Decisions on which songs to include are often influenced by chart performance, streaming data, and audience feedback from previous performances. In the context of a Walmart AMP concert, a balance that resonates with a broad demographic is typically favored.

  • Strategic Song Placement for Energy Management

    The order in which songs are performed is crucial for managing the concert’s energy level. Opening with a high-energy track is common to immediately engage the audience. Slower, more intimate songs are often interspersed throughout the set to provide moments of respite and emotional connection. The concluding songs typically consist of the artist’s most popular and energetic material, leaving the audience with a lasting impression. A poorly sequenced setlist can result in a disjointed experience, leading to decreased audience engagement and overall dissatisfaction. Effective pacing is particularly important in an outdoor venue like Walmart AMP, where maintaining audience attention over an extended period requires careful consideration.

  • Adapting to Audience Response and Venue Characteristics

    Experienced performers often adjust their setlists in real-time based on the audience’s reaction. Songs that elicit strong responses may be extended, while those that fail to resonate may be shortened or omitted altogether. The specific characteristics of the venue, such as its size and acoustics, can also influence setlist decisions. An outdoor venue like Walmart AMP may necessitate adjustments to audio levels and song arrangements to compensate for the environmental conditions. The ability to adapt to these dynamic factors is a hallmark of a seasoned performer and can significantly enhance the concert experience.

8. Merchandise Sales

Merchandise sales represent a significant revenue stream for musical artists performing at venues such as Walmart AMP, including a hypothetical Maggie Rogers concert. These sales extend beyond simple revenue generation, serving as a tangible connection between the artist and their audience, fostering brand loyalty and providing lasting reminders of the concert experience.

  • Types of Merchandise

    The range of merchandise offered at a concert often includes apparel (t-shirts, hoodies), accessories (posters, hats, tote bags), and physical media (vinyl records, CDs). The selection is typically curated to align with the artist’s brand and aesthetic. For Maggie Rogers, merchandise might feature designs inspired by her album artwork or song lyrics. Offering a diverse selection caters to varying price points and preferences, maximizing sales potential. The availability of exclusive, limited-edition items can further incentivize purchases, creating a sense of urgency and collectibility.

  • Venue-Specific Considerations

    The venue itself, Walmart AMP, influences merchandise sales through logistical factors. The available space for merchandise booths, the accessibility of these booths to concert attendees, and the presence of competing vendors all impact sales volume. Outdoor venues require consideration of weather protection for merchandise displays. Effective booth placement in high-traffic areas is crucial for maximizing visibility and impulse purchases. Contracts between the artist and the venue dictate the percentage of merchandise revenue retained by each party. Understanding these logistical and contractual factors is essential for accurate sales forecasting and revenue management.

  • Pricing Strategies

    Merchandise pricing is a critical determinant of sales volume. Prices must be competitive with comparable items while also reflecting the perceived value of the artist’s brand. Psychological pricing strategies, such as ending prices in .99, may be employed to influence purchasing decisions. Bundling merchandise items at a discounted price can incentivize higher-value transactions. The implementation of dynamic pricing, adjusting prices based on demand throughout the concert, is less common but may be considered for certain items. Accurate pricing requires a thorough understanding of production costs, competitor pricing, and the perceived value of the artist’s brand among their fanbase.

  • Online Integration

    The integration of online sales channels with the in-person merchandise experience can further enhance revenue generation. Offering a pre-sale of exclusive merchandise items online, with the option for pick-up at the concert, can generate excitement and guarantee sales. Conversely, unsold merchandise from the concert can be offered online after the event, extending the sales window and mitigating potential losses. Utilizing social media to promote merchandise and provide direct links to online purchasing platforms is essential for maximizing reach and driving sales. The seamless integration of online and offline sales channels represents a best practice for modern merchandise management.

Question 3: What are the standard venue policies at Walmart AMP?

Standard venue policies at Walmart AMP generally prohibit outside food and beverages, professional cameras and recording equipment, and items deemed potentially hazardous. A comprehensive list of prohibited items is available on the Walmart AMP website.

Question 4: Are there any age restrictions for attending concerts at Walmart AMP?

Age restrictions, if any, are specific to the event and will be clearly indicated during the ticket purchasing process. Some events may be all-ages, while others may have restrictions due to content or time of day.

Question 5: What are the parking options for events at Walmart AMP?

Parking options typically include on-site parking lots and designated off-site parking areas with shuttle services to the venue. Specific parking information, including costs and availability, is usually provided in pre-event communications and on the Walmart AMP website.

Question 6: How does inclement weather affect concerts at Walmart AMP?

Walmart AMP is an outdoor venue, and performances are generally rain-or-shine. However, in cases of severe weather, event organizers may delay, postpone, or cancel the performance. Updates regarding weather-related changes are communicated through the venue’s official channels.

Maximizing the “maggie rogers walmart amp” Concert Experience

These guidelines aim to enhance the concert experience at an outdoor venue, specifically in relation to a hypothetical Maggie Rogers performance at the Walmart AMP. Adherence to these recommendations can improve comfort, safety, and overall enjoyment.

Tip 1: Prioritize Early Ticket Purchase. Secure tickets well in advance of the performance date to guarantee entry and potentially benefit from early-bird pricing. Popular artists often sell out quickly, making proactive ticket acquisition crucial.

Tip 2: Arrive Early to Mitigate Logistical Challenges. Early arrival addresses potential issues with parking, security lines, and seating selection. It allows ample time to navigate the venue and familiarize oneself with amenities.

Tip 3: Familiarize Yourself with Venue Policies. Review the Walmart AMP’s official website for a comprehensive list of prohibited items and specific venue regulations. Compliance with these policies ensures a smooth entry process and avoids potential confiscation of prohibited items.

Tip 4: Plan for Weather Contingencies. Outdoor concerts are subject to weather conditions. Consult the forecast prior to the event and dress accordingly. Consider bringing rain gear or sunscreen, depending on the predicted weather patterns. Layering clothing allows for adaptability to temperature fluctuations.

Tip 5: Hydrate Consistently. Outdoor venues, especially during warmer months, can lead to dehydration. Consume water regularly throughout the event. Be aware of the venue’s policy regarding outside beverages and plan accordingly.

Tip 6: Protect Hearing. Prolonged exposure to loud music can cause hearing damage. Consider using earplugs to mitigate the risk of noise-induced hearing loss, particularly if positioned close to the speakers.

Tip 7: Designate a Meeting Point. For attendees attending in groups, establish a designated meeting point within the venue in case of separation. This minimizes confusion and facilitates reunification.
